Transaction 96766ea3bf70b708516f170b8d671ff145202092eef1ddd120b21582cdfef47a
2 Input
2 Outputs
- 96766ea3bf70b708516f170b8d671ff145202092eef1ddd120b21582cdfef47a:0
- 96766ea3bf70b708516f170b8d671ff145202092eef1ddd120b21582cdfef47a:1
value 86224068
address 3Mek9CUGo99byMrLKCfMSakCUF6hqR3vTU
value 20000
address 3K1jXTKZCwAe2mgGRzCgNjoKHPnqq4AfnQ